Montague & Zanker
Montague Expi
San Jose, CA 95134
The bus stop at Montague & Zanker in San Jose, CA, is a convenient location for commuters in the bustling Montague Expressway area.
Generated from this place's information
See a problem?
The bus stop at Montague & Zanker in San Jose, CA, is a convenient location for commuters in the bustling Montague Expressway area.
Generated from this place's information